Job Description

ACCOUNTABILITIES:

Definition & deployment of assessment activities:

  • Plan and follow-up Independent safety assessment activities for the assigned projects
  • Deploy safety assessment applying reference Independent safety assessment process and tools in consistency with applicable standards and regulations
  • Deliver safety assessment report for the defined key milestones
  • Present the assessment results to the Project/Product team, and if necessary, to the management or to external entity as customer/railway safety authority
  • Manage Independent Safety Assessment findings, log

ISA Process management:

  • Support the Independent Safety Assessment director or Safety Assessment lead in capturing assessment requests
  • Apply reference Independent safety assessment process and tools, and contribute to its improvement using REX process.
  • Estimate and Measure workload of assigned projects

Others:

  • Support safety reviews or other independent assessments as requested
  • Develop safety expertise and provide contribution to other assessors
  • Contribute to successful achievement of internal/external audits process compliance
  • Perform Safety audits, generate audit reports and follow up audit findings
  • In line with applicable rules of independence provide Safety Awareness training and mentoring to the Engineering organization

Performance measurements:

Respect of QCD commitment along DFQ cycle

SKILLS & EDUCATION:

Educational Requirements:

Master Degree in Engineering or similar technical fields

Experience:

  • 5 years of experience in railway safety domain or 5 years in railway domain (including 2 years in railway safety domain)
  • (WCE) Expert in Safety
  • Knowledge of Alstom Ethics & Compliance policy
  • Knowledge of Alstom EHS policy and Alstom Zero Deviations rules
  • Experience in Audit

Competencies & Skills:

  • Rigorous and structured with the ability to work against deadlines
  • Ability to challenge and ability to say no
  • Fluent in English, Communication, Pugnacious, resilience, negotiation
  • Technical skills in railway safety process and related methods and tools
  • Technical skills in railway operational context and system / products functional and technical characteristics
  • Knowledge of railway safety standards and regulations
